Purpose:The National Director, Leasing and Revenue Management develops and oversees the strategic leasing and corresponding supportive marketing plans for all multi-residential properties across Minto’s national portfolio. Leading a team of leasing and revenue management professionals, this role plays a pivotal part in the team’s business and growth plans. This role will harness effective collaboration across the company to ensure the success of the team and provide exceptional customer service to our prospective tenants.In this role, you will:
- Develop and implement comprehensive sales and leasing strategies to enhance market presence and achieve targets.
- Lead and mentor high-performing leasing and revenue management teams, fostering a culture of excellence and collaboration.
- Develop and support strategic lease-up plans for new developments.
- Working with the Director, Digital Marketing and Advertising, support the development and execution of marketing strategy and plans including analytics and insights, communication, marketing collateral, advertising and promotional plans/materials to achieve awareness, lead generation and customer experience objectives.
- Conducts lease analyses of proposed lease deals to ascertain the best negotiating position and/or return for the landlord; prepares proposals based on negotiating strategies.
- Stays current with the real estate market and maintains contact with the real estate brokerage community
- Provides recommendations to target vacancies and investigates appropriate areas for prospects.
- Builds, manages and maintains a high-performance team through effective talent recruitment, coaching, and development.
- Sets high standards, establishes accountabilities, and measures performance consistent with Minto’s Values.
- Ensures all parties adhere to health and safety standards and promote a healthy and safe work environment.
- Ensure compliance with legal, regulatory, and company standards in sales and leasing operations.
- Other duties within the scope, spirit and purpose of the job, as requested by management.
